New Leads Announced for Off-Broadway’s ‘Little Shop of Horrors’

Jordan Fisher, Nikki M. James, and Andy Karl are getting ready to take the stage at the Westside Theatre in the Off-Broadway revival of “Little Shop of Horrors.”

Fisher will assume the role of Seymour, while James will take over as Audrey starting March 6. Karl will join the company as Dr. Orin Scrivello, D.D.S. on March 10.

Joshua Bassett and Joy Woods, who currently portray Seymour and Audrey, are scheduled to give their final performances on March 1. Understudies will cover the roles from March 3 through March 5. Andrew Durand, who plays Orin, will depart the show following his final performance on March 8.

Producer Tom Kirdahy acknowledged the contributions of the outgoing cast in a statement, sharing, “Joshua and Joy have brought such sincerity, joy, and soul to Seymour and Audrey. Their performances have been a true gift to this production, and we are deeply grateful for the magic they’ve shared with our company and audiences.”

The current cast of “Little Shop of Horrors” also includes Christopher Swan as Mushnik, Christian McQueen as the voice of Audrey II, and Christine Wanda, Savannah Lee Birdsong, and Morgan Ashley Bryant as the Urchins.

The ensemble features Teddy Yudain, Weston Chandler Long, Mecca Hicks, Jeff Sears, Aveena Sawyer, Mike Masters, Alloria Frayser, Chani Maisonet, Johnny Newcomb, Jon Hoche, Jonothon Lyons, and Noel MacNeal.

Since the revival began, the production has featured numerous well-known performers in its lead roles. Past Seymours and Audreys include Jonathan Groff, Jeremy Jordan, Lena Hall, Darren Criss, Matt Doyle, Skylar Astin, Evan Rachel Wood, Constance Wu, Sarah Hyland, Andrew Barth Feldman, and Corbin Bleu. Jinkx Monsoon made history during the run by becoming the first drag queen to portray Audrey in a major production of the musical.

Directed by Michael Mayer, the revival features choreography by Ellenore Scott, with scenic design by Julian Crouch, lighting by Bradley King, costumes by Tom Broecker, sound design by Jessica Paz, and puppet design by Nicholas Mahon, with original puppets by Martin P. Robinson. Music supervision, orchestration, and arrangements are by Will Van Dyke. Casting is by Jim Carnahan, with puppets provided by Monkey Boys Productions.
